Jake Oliveira is the Democratic State Senator for Massachusetts' Hampden, Hampshire, and Worcester District, which spans twelve communities including his hometown of Ludlow, where he resides. A product of public education, he earned a B.A. from Framingham State University and has spent over two decades in public service — including twelve years on the Ludlow School Committee, a term as President of the Massachusetts Association of School Committees, and work in government relations for the Massachusetts State Universities. He was elected to the Massachusetts House (7th Hampden District) in 2020 and to the State Senate in 2022, where he chairs the Joint Committee on Labor and Workforce Development and serves as Vice Chair of the Joint Committee on Election Laws.

Where does Jacob R. Oliveira stand on the issues?

Jacob R. Oliveira has a recorded position on eight issues. Each is Civoren's summary of the campaign's own public material, with the source linked.

  • Cost of Living & Affordability

    Supports

    Oliveira identifies affordability as Massachusetts' main challenge in 2026, citing crippling utility delivery charges, housing costs, and healthcare costs, and arguing residents should not have to choose between paying for electricity, groceries, or medicine.

    "People shouldn't have to choose between paying for electricity and buying groceries, or paying a bill or buying medicine," Oliveira said. ... Oliveira explained that utility costs are "crippling" seniors and those on fixed incomes.

  • Free Speech

    Supports

    Oliveira opposes book bans: he has secured over $3 million in additional state aid for regional public libraries and has filed legislation to prevent book banning at public libraries across Massachusetts.

    A strong advocate for public libraries, Jake has secured over $3 million in additional state aid for regional public libraries in the past two fiscal years and has filed legislation to prevent book banning at public libraries across the Commonwealth.

  • Healthcare Access & Affordability

    Supports

    Oliveira targets healthcare affordability, warning that 10% annual cost increases are "crowding out" other government programs, supports reining in pharmacy benefit managers that drive up drug prices, and filed legislation to allow physician assistants licensed in other states to practice in Massachusetts to ease the provider shortage.

    Oliveira said those intermediaries - the three largest of whom are Optum RX, CVS Caremark and Express Scripts - are profitable and drive up prices.

  • Higher Education Affordability

    Supports

    A "proud product of public education" and founding member of PHENOM (the Public Higher Education Network of Massachusetts), Oliveira is a long-time advocate for public higher education and, as Assistant Executive Officer of the Massachusetts State Universities Council of Presidents, helped rename seven state colleges to state universities.

    A proud product of public education, Jake earned a Bachelor of Arts from Framingham State University after Ludlow High. At Framingham State, he served three years on the campus Board of Trustees, was a student member of the Massachusetts Board of Higher Education, and was a founding member of PHENOM-the Public Higher Education Network of Massachusetts.

  • Housing & Development

    Supports

    Oliveira favors mixed-use housing and redeveloping vacant industrial buildings (citing the Ludlow Mills), wants to end age caps that lock younger and middle-aged buyers out of age-restricted developments, and defends the Affordable Homes Act's affordability requirements while calling for a balanced approach rather than a one-size-fits-all mandate.

    "I'm a big fan of mixed-use housing," Oliveira said. ... "We need to end a lot of these age caps," Oliveira said.

  • K-12 Education

    Supports

    Oliveira is an "ardent supporter of public education"; his stated top priority is ensuring public schools receive a fair share of funding and fighting attacks on LGBTQ students and teachers.

    Education: Throughout my career, I have been an ardent supporter of public education. As state senator, I will work to ensure that our schools receive a fair share of funding, and I will lead the fight against the ongoing Republican attacks against LGBT students and teachers.
